A highly regio- and stereo-selective synthesis of cyclic β-D-glucosides 3 via Pd(0)-catalyzed coupling cyclization of allenyl β-D-glucoside 1 and organic iodides in 20-38% yields is reported. After the deacetylation of 3, we obtained cyclic β-D-glucoses 4 in 90-97% yields, which may have SGLT2 inhibition activities.

The present study examined modifications of β-naphthoflavone (β-NF)-induced cytochrome P450 1A1 (CYP1A1) expression by flavonoids in mouse hepatocytes in primary culture. Some flavonoids (apigenin, chrysin, flavone, flavanone, galangin, luteolin, and naringenin) by themselves induced CYP1A1 mRNA expression, especially flavone which was even more effective than β-NF. ABSTR ACT: Resveratrol was glucosylated to its 3and 4′-β-glucosides by the glucosyltransferase PaGT3 from Phytolacca americana expressed in Bacillus subtilis. PaGT3 glucosylated pterostilbene to its 4′-β-glucoside. Piceatannol was converted into its 4′-β-glucoside by PaGT3.
